When is the best time to visit Rabat
Rabat's flight prices and atmosphere shift dramatically year-round. Spring and autumn bring peak rates but perfect weather, summer and winter offer the cheapest deals with fewer crowds, while shoulder months balance comfort and savings for smart travelers.
- Prices: Peak rates for flights and hotels; book 6-8 weeks ahead for better deals, especially avoiding festival weekends.
- Weather: Pleasant 15–26 °C with mild conditions, 3–6 rainy days per month in spring, drier in autumn.
- Events: Mawazine Festival (May) draws global artists, Jazz au Chellah (September) offers concerts in ancient ruins, and Rabat International Film Festival (October) showcases cinema.
- Prices: Cheapest flights and accommodation year-round; summer heat and winter rain deter crowds, making last-minute bookings feasible with significant savings versus peak spring rates.
- Weather: Summer 22–28 °C with dry heat, winter 8–16 °C with 6–8 rainy days monthly; both contrast spring's mild comfort.
- Events: Rabat Beach Festival (July-August) enlivens the coast, National Folklore Festival (July) celebrates Moroccan heritage.
- Prices: Moderate rates with flights dropping 20-25% compared to April-May peak; book 3-4 weeks ahead for optimal deals before Mawazine (late May) or after summer.
- Weather: Comfortable 12–24 °C with March seeing 4–6 rainy days, while June and November stay drier with 3–4 days of precipitation monthly.
- Events: Early Mawazine preparations (March), Rabat Beach Festival kickoff (June), and post-autumn cultural events offer entertainment without overwhelming crowds.

Navigating Rabat’s Airport and Airlines
Rabat’s Salé Airport (RBA) serves as a convenient gateway to the city, located just about 11 kilometers from downtown—a quick taxi ride or light railway commute away. Flights from major European hubs are frequent, with affordable options largely available via budget carriers like Ryanair alongside full-service airlines for those seeking enhanced comfort.

Weather in Rabat
Average Weather
| Month | Average monthly max temperature | Average monthly min temperature |
| January | 17°C | 10°C |
| February | 17°C | 10°C |
| March | 19°C | 11°C |
| April | 21°C | 13°C |
| May | 23°C | 16°C |
| June | 25°C | 18°C |
| July | 27°C | 20°C |
| August | 28°C | 21°C |
| September | 26°C | 20°C |
| October | 25°C | 18°C |
| November | 21°C | 14°C |
| December | 18°C | 12°C |
